I bought this car for just £200 over 3 years ago as a cheap runaround for town use. However, it has done a fair share of long motorway runs and happily cruises at 70 mph even up long inclines and is surprisingly quiet when on the motorway. Despite its very small boot, it is surprisingly practical. I have managed to get a king size bed and a chest of drawers from Ikea inside and I can (just) get 2.4 metre lengths of wood inside as well. It will carry lawnmowers, it helps that the front passenger seat tips forward assisting with the carriage of long loads. An excellent turning circle makes it ideal in town but potholes upset its composure and its narrow track mean that some speedbumps can be more annoying than they need to be. However, overall, it does all the grotty jobs well and at £93 per year to insure, I would not want to be without it. To date, it has done 107,000 miles and uses no oil, starts on the first touch of the key.
